기타언어초록

Purpose : To evaluate the changes and normal ranges of the artery-bronchus ratio(ABR) during respirationMaterials and Methods : We analyzed HRCT of 10healthy adults. The HRCT findings of ten healthy adults were analysed CT scanning was performed with 1mm collimation at 3mm intervals during full inspiration and full expiration, with a range during inspiration from 2cm to 4cm above the carina and from 4cm above to 2cm below the right hemidiaphragm. The range during expiration was from 1cm to 3cm above the carina and from 4cm above to 2cm below the right hemidiaphragm. ABiR (defined as the diameter of pulmonary artery divided by the inner diameter of the bronchus) and ABoR (defined as the diameter of pulmonary artery divided by the outer diameter of the bronchus) and BLR (defined as the inner diameter of the bronchus divided by the outer diameter of the bronchus) were measured on the display console.Results : The mean inner diameter of the bronchi was 2.04$pm$0.73mm during inspiration and 1.68$pm$0.51mm during expiration, while the mean diameter of the arteries was 3.95$pm$1.03mm during inspiration and 4.37$pm$1.09mm during expiration. The diameters of the bronchi were thus seen to increase during inspiration, and the diameters of the pulmonary arteries, to decrease. The mean thickness of the bronchial wall 1.07$pm$0.19mm during inspiration and 1.06$pm$0.24mm during expiration; thus, no change in thickness was seen during respiration (p<0.05). Mean ABiR was 2.01$pm$0.60 (rang 1.15-4.58) during inspiration and 2.59$pm$0.74(range 1.16-4.9) during expiration, and in all cases the inner diameter of the bronchus was less than that of the accompanying pulmonary artery. Mean ABoR was 0.91$pm$0.19 during inspiration and 1.09$pm$0.22 during expiration. while for BLR, the corresponding fingures were 0.46$pm$0.06, and 0.44$pm$0.09.Conclusion : HRCT is a useful tool for evaluating changes in the pulmonary arteries and bronchi during respiration.
